Airbnb was born in 2007 when two hosts welcomed three guests to their San Francisco home, and has since grown to over 5 million hosts who have welcomed over 2 billion guest arrivals in almost every country across the globe. Every day, hosts offer unique stays and experiences that make it possible for guests to connect with communities in a more authentic way.

The Difference You Will Make:

This position will primarily support Airbnb’s Customer Support (CS) Product Marketing and Platform teams, which are responsible for supporting our global host and guest community by building a technology platform that scales alongside Airbnb, delivering exceptional customer service and improving both efficiency and agent experience. These teams are focused on evolving and expanding products like an AI-powered customer service agent, plus leveraging AI to improve tools for our CS agents.  These teams also frequently adapt agent tooling and the CS platform to support a wide variety of new features and other initiatives impacting our users The teams covered and this role is collaborative and highly cross-functional. The role is challenging and requires a pragmatic, strategic leader and business advisor who has a strong background in AI/ML, global regulations and compliance challenges, and consumer protection issues. Familiarity with global privacy laws is key.
In this role, you will be responsible for supporting and providing advice and guidance to the product marketing, platform, operations, design, and engineering teams. You must have excellent judgment in calibrating legal risk against business strategy, and a proven ability to learn new areas of law and function independently in a demanding, fast-paced environment. We’re looking for a highly adaptable and collaborative person who can handle ambiguity and rapidly shifting priorities with flexibility, patience, and poise.  Previous product counsel or analogous experience is required. Your role will require a high degree of self-sufficiency, organizational skills, and proactivity. You will join a supportive, low ego, and friendly product and marketing legal team.

A Typical Day:

  • Advise business, product marketing, platform, design, and engineering teams throughout the product development and operations lifecycle on a broad range of legal issues.
  • Serve as day-to-day partner for business teams in order to understand the product roadmap and priorities, providing pragmatic and strategic advice in your area of coverage, to mitigate legal risks while advancing business interests. Responsible for driving thoughtful, well supported escalations when appropriate.
  • Drive consensus building across legal and coordinate advice on complex legal issues, particularly on laws and regulations dealing with AI/ML, privacy, consumer protection, employment, and other risk areas related to current and proposed business activities.
  • Collaborate effectively with global and functional legal counterparts to ensure consistency in guidance and advice that balances regional and local risks with global business needs and constraints.
  • Draft clear and concise risk analyses, client communications, memos, in-product disclosures and disclaimers, FAQs, terms of use, policies, and implement related processes.
  • Manage outside counsel on complex research issues with an eye toward driving business goals while effectively managing time and cost.

Your Expertise:

  • A JD with 12+ years of relevant experience in law firms, governmental agencies, and/or in-house legal departments.
  • Prior product counseling or analogous experience is required. In-house experience at a multinational, consumer-facing technology company is strongly preferred.
  • Barred in a US state, preferably CA, or eligible to register as California Registered In-House Counsel.
  • Knowledge of and meaningful experience applying a variety of regulations and industry guidelines (e.g. consumer protection law, the EU AI Act and US state AI laws, privacy laws like GDPR andCCPA/CPRA, CDA 230, DMCA, E-Commerce Directive, DSA/DMA, and employee misclassification) – including advising in nascent regulatory areas and on shifting regulatory priorities.

What you need to know about the Charlotte Tech Scene

Ranked among the hottest tech cities in 2024 by CompTIA, Charlotte is quickly cementing its place as a major U.S. tech hub. Home to more than 90,000 tech workers, the city’s ecosystem is primed for continued growth, fueled by billions in annual funding from heavyweights like Microsoft and RevTech Labs, which has created thousands of fintech jobs and made the city a go-to for tech pros looking for their next big opportunity.

Key Facts About Charlotte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 90,859; 6.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Lowe’s, Bank of America, TIAA, Microsoft, Honeywell
  • Key Industries: Fintech, artificial intelligence, cybersecurity, cloud computing, e-commerce
  • Funding Landscape: $3.1 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(CED)
  • Notable Investors: Microsoft, Google, Falfurrias Management Partners, RevTech Labs Foundation
  • Research Centers and Universities: University of North Carolina at Charlotte, Northeastern University, North Carolina Research Campus
